12V 4632-2838 Miniature DC Brushless Motor Worm Gear Deceleration Self-Locking Large Torque Forward And Reverse Speed Regulation
USD 14.85
12V 4632-2838 Miniature DC Brushless Motor Worm Gear Deceleration Self-Locking Large Torque Forward And Reverse Speed Regulation